The Wonderfactory: User Experience Designer
(New York, NY) UX Designers are responsible for concepting design experiences, interfaces, and interaction models for both web and application based systems.
- Translates requirements, feature concepts, use cases, and design challenges into site maps, user flows, user scenarios, wireframe schematics, prototypes and functional specification documents.
- Has a core understanding for web-based design and implications of dynamic User Interface Design
- Create highly usable and innovative web-based sites & applications.
- Learn & understand the core usability constructs and UX design principles.
- Support user experience research and usability testing efforts to ensure that the user interface is useful and extremely easy to use.
- Be an active participant in user centered design activity & be a constant advocate for the end user.
- Collaborates as integral member of the UX design, visual design, and development teams
- Help to coordinate and communicate project information and tasks between internal groups.
- Participates in the development of creative solutions to user experience challenges.
- Identifies, addresses and solves user interface design problems
- Learn, understand and interpret user research and usability testing and effectively applies the findings to designs
- Collaborates with other disciplines to define the vision and requirements for a product or programming area.
